Academic Operations Administrator
\nFull time (35 hrs/wk), permanent
\nSplit place of work between Horizons (Reading, Berkshire) and Home, with up to three days a week at home
\nSalary range £25,000 to £27,000 pa plus benefits
\nWe're looking for an Academic Operations Administrator to join our Academic Operations team and help ensure the smooth delivery of our academic programmes. You will play a vital role in ensuring programmes are delivered effectively and efficiently, supporting both academic staff and students.
\nYou will be responsible for coordinating lecturer resourcing across a range of programmes. You'll prepare and issue contracts, support onboarding activities, monitor compliance with mandatory training requirements, and help to ensure lecturers are assigned appropriately to meet operational needs.
\nThis is an excellent opportunity to join a supportive team and contribute to the successful delivery of high-quality academic programmes.
\nYour accountabilities and responsibilities include:
\n- \n
- Assist with the planning and preparation of semester resourcing for the University’s academic programmes \n
- Arrange and issue contracts in liaison with the HR and Payroll team \n
- Liaise with and notify the relevant teams about the lecturer arrangements for all modules \n
